A theater charges $5.25 per ticket. The theater has already sold 40 tickets. Write and solve an inequality that represents how man more tickets the theater needs to sell to earr at least $400.

37 more tickets

This is because
40 x $5.25 = $210
77 x $5.25 = $404.25
40-77=37
Therefore the theater needs to sell 37 more tickets.
